Rainbow in a Glass Experiment Materials Needed: Sugar Water Food coloring (red, yellow, green, blue) Tablespoon 5 glasses Pipette or syringe Procedure: Prepare the Glasses: Fill 4 glasses with water, leaving one empty. Add 2-3 drops of different food coloring to each glass (red, yellow, green, blue). Add Sugar: Add sugar to the glasses with yellow, green, and blue food coloring. Use 1.

Ingredients To create your Melting Rainbow Science Experiment, you will need: Baking soda Dish soap Food coloring in rainbow colors Vinegar Pipette Instructions Start by pouring a tablespoon of baking soda into six small containers. Add a few drops of food coloring to each container to create a vibrant rainbow. Use red, orange, yellow, green, blue, and purple. Add a squirt of dish soap to each.
